Ravi Dai Newa Chen, formerly known as Dattatraya Khaja Ghar, is a beloved eatery in Bhaktapur that has been serving authentic Newari cuisine for over 30 years. Situated just to the right of the historic Dattatraya Temple, this restaurant is a true gem for anyone seeking a taste of traditional Newari flavors.
The highlight of Ravi Dai Newa Chen is undoubtedly their boka ko masu (goat curry). Known as the best goat curry in town, it is richly flavored and cooked to perfection, offering tender pieces of goat meat simmered in a robust, spiced gravy. The depth of flavor in this dish reflects the restaurant's commitment to maintaining the authentic taste and preparation methods of Newari cuisine.
Another standout dish is the boka tauko sadheko (marinated goat head). This dish is a delightful mix of textures and flavors, making it a must-try for adventurous eaters and those who appreciate traditional Newari delicacies. The chicken leg curry is also worth mentioning, with its tender meat and flavorful sauce that strikes the perfect balance of spices.
